1. Specifications Comparison
| Feature | Huawei P60 Pro | Motorola Moto G54 | Practical Impact |
|---|---|---|---|
| Design | |||
| Dimensions (mm) | 161 x 74.5 x 8.3 | 161.6 x 73.8 x 8 | Virtually identical in size |
| Weight (g) | 200 | 177 | P60 Pro feels slightly more substantial |
| Build Materials | Not specified | Not specified | Cannot compare build quality |
| Display | |||
| Display Type | LTPO OLED | IPS LCD | P60 Pro offers deeper blacks, better contrast, and potentially better power efficiency due to LTPO. G54's LCD might be brighter outdoors. |
| Size (inches) | 6.67 | 6.5 | Negligible difference in screen real estate |
| Resolution | 1220 x 2700 | 1080 x 2400 | P60 Pro noticeably sharper due to higher pixel density (444 ppi vs 405 ppi) |
| Refresh Rate (Hz) | 120 | 120 | Both offer smooth scrolling and animations |
| Performance | |||
| Chipset | Snapdragon 8+ Gen 1 4G | MediaTek Dimensity 7020 | P60 Pro significantly more powerful, enabling smoother multitasking, faster app loading, and better gaming performance. |
| CPU | Octa-core (1x3.19 GHz X2 & 3x2.75 GHz A710 & 4x2.0 GHz A510) | Octa-core (2x2.2 GHz A78 & 6x2.0 GHz A55) | P60 Pro has a more powerful CPU architecture |
| GPU | Adreno 730 | IMG BXM-8-256 | P60 Pro offers significantly better graphics performance for demanding games and applications. |
| RAM (GB) | 8/12 | 8/12 | Dependent on configuration, both can offer smooth multitasking. |
| Camera | |||
| Main Camera (MP) | 48 MP (Sony IMX888) | 50 MP | P60 Pro utilizes a larger sensor (1/1.4") likely resulting in better low-light performance despite lower resolution. |
| Telephoto | 48 MP (3.5x Optical Zoom) | None | P60 Pro offers optical zoom for better image quality at longer distances. G54 lacks telephoto capabilities. |
| Ultrawide | 13 MP | None listed, potentially included but not specified | P60 Pro has an ultrawide lens, offering a wider field of view. Unclear for G54. |
| Video Recording | Up to 4K@60fps with EIS | Up to 1080p@60fps | P60 Pro capable of higher resolution video recording with better stabilization. |
| Battery | |||
| Capacity (mAh) | 4815 | 5000 | G54 slightly larger battery capacity. |
| Fast Charging | 88W Wired, 50W Wireless | 15W Wired | P60 Pro charges significantly faster both wired and wirelessly. |
2. Key Differences Analysis
Huawei P60 Pro Advantages:
- Superior Performance: The Snapdragon 8+ Gen 1 significantly outperforms the Dimensity 7020, providing a smoother and more responsive user experience.
- Higher Quality Display: The LTPO OLED offers better contrast, deeper blacks, and potentially improved power efficiency.
- More Versatile Camera System: The triple camera setup with a dedicated telephoto lens and larger main sensor provides greater flexibility and better image quality. Faster wired and wireless charging capabilities.
Motorola Moto G54 Advantages:
- Lower Price: Significantly more affordable.
- Slightly Larger Battery: Potentially longer battery life, although real-world usage will depend on factors like the display and chipset. 5G connectivity.
Trade-offs:
- The P60 Pro sacrifices 5G connectivity (likely due to US sanctions).
